Table 3-9
Gateway-Serial SNMP Trap Event Types
Event Type
Trap is sent when ...
RAI status
A change in RAI status occurs.
Bad video
Corrupt or empty video packets are present
in the LifeSize Gateway. Includes the ID
number of the call during which the event
occurs.
Power-up
The LifeSize Gateway has started to operate.
Power-down
The LifeSize Gateway is shutting down.
Gatekeeper
A change occurs in the registration status of
registration state
the LifeSize Gateway.
change
Loss of Ethernet
The network returns after going down.
Indicates the time at which the network was
restored.
Max resource
A call could not be established because of a
meter
lack of one of the following resources—
CPU, audio transcoder, DTMF detector or
T.120 resources.
Network problem A problem occurs on the network.
Card extract/Hot
A card has been removed from the LifeSize
Swap
chassis under power or inserted into the
chassis under power, or the when the
LifeSize Gateway enters maintenance mode.
Abnormal
A call has disconnected for a reason other
disconnect
than normal, busy or no answer.
Corrupt IVR
Corrupt IVR files are present in the LifeSize
messages on host
Gateway.
